The Christian Council of Ghana and the Ghana Catholic Bishops Conference have both endorsed the position of the Methodist Church in the issue regarding preventing Muslim Students from fasting.

In a joint statement, Christian organisations both believe the decision by the Methodist Church not to allow the girls to fast is in the good interest of the students.

They indicated that the rules and regulations of mission schools have always been guided by traditions of the Churches and there is the need to uphold them, indicating that they have ensure discipline and high academic standards over the years.

The statement also admoniahed the Ghana Education Service not to undermine the code of conduct for the various mission schools.
